diff options
author | Richard Farina <zerochaos@gentoo.org> | 2012-07-03 22:27:31 +0000 |
---|---|---|
committer | Richard Farina <zerochaos@gentoo.org> | 2012-07-03 22:27:31 +0000 |
commit | bed141371badc12e53961b13da38f3c850979f3b (patch) | |
tree | 8296f0e119a84590b57ead4958679007e258bd39 /app-crypt | |
parent | Version bump. keyword amd64-linux and x86-linux (diff) | |
download | historical-bed141371badc12e53961b13da38f3c850979f3b.tar.gz historical-bed141371badc12e53961b13da38f3c850979f3b.tar.bz2 historical-bed141371badc12e53961b13da38f3c850979f3b.zip |
fix loader location and minor ebuild style improvements
Package-Manager: portage-2.1.11.3/cvs/Linux x86_64
Diffstat (limited to 'app-crypt')
-rw-r--r-- | app-crypt/hashcat-bin/ChangeLog | 5 | ||||
-rw-r--r-- | app-crypt/hashcat-bin/Manifest | 30 | ||||
-rw-r--r-- | app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ild | 30 |
3 files changed, 36 insertions, 29 deletions
diff --git a/app-crypt/hashcat-bin/ChangeLog b/app-crypt/hashcat-bin/ChangeLog index eb8c91953e18..cd96b6de0b66 100644 --- a/app-crypt/hashcat-bin/ChangeLog +++ b/app-crypt/hashcat-bin/ChangeLog @@ -1,6 +1,9 @@ # ChangeLog for app-crypt/hashcat-bin #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-crypt/hashcat-bin/ChangeLog,v 1.2 2012/07/02 01:19:04 zerochaos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-crypt/hashcat-bin/ChangeLog,v 1.3 2012/07/03 22:27:31 zerochaos Exp $ + + 03 Jul 2012; Rick Farina <zerochaos@gentoo.org> hashcat-bin-0.39.ebuild: + fix loader location and minor ebuild style improvements 02 Jul 2012; Rick Farina <zerochaos@gentoo.org> hashcat-bin-0.39.ebuild: trade RESTRICT=binchecks for QA_PREBUILT diff --git a/app-crypt/hashcat-bin/Manifest b/app-crypt/hashcat-bin/Manifest index 6324d7527a42..cd7f8669ffa2 100644 --- a/app-crypt/hashcat-bin/Manifest +++ b/app-crypt/hashcat-bin/Manifest @@ -2,23 +2,23 @@ Hash: SHA1 DIST hashcat-0.39.7z 716387 RMD160 d5c8983c5938e273d055772a1ae59970e5109beb SHA1 baf0d3660cfc241c635f772eef1682980744521d SHA256 9d86cb175030de5b5872077028456f944c18e94749fc79cb63fb2f74106bed4e -EBUILD hashcat-bin-0.39.ebuild 1865 RMD160 e5c5f75a4d780d456ca2f97d50fc5d48266d632a SHA1 c72742e667d838d4f26c5613b0c29bacbbcf838a SHA256 3fb2844fbe4241218b0791abc77bdd875b11435444012ab11768949a3557395e -MISC ChangeLog 473 RMD160 07411446471fddfcf61e08d12f42b7018581da1a SHA1 06e379e3826309ad74540445ec8ab47a986bf0bc SHA256 ede1cb632199d349df9496ce24e3791cbbfa3dab0fed0b1d6f38bdbfdd7cf01f +EBUILD hashcat-bin-0.39.ebuild 1628 RMD160 a57d37ad06013988f4087add2f3669c6dcbe169c SHA1 41b36b370bd8740d542add893b4e332e8f5e42d9 SHA256 9b09c221058df081947a93f52cf8f9df684495e4b32e26dfc504887267e52590 +MISC ChangeLog 607 RMD160 c266759faf66101b0a038ffb74d95cf08cdc5792 SHA1 acef81f3f96c97527279e184af0c9ded7e1096a4 SHA256 bf413312483e16de6ac04db1ec4d85f3a73e85daf59c946efc0380f369d1c207 MISC metadata.xml 248 RMD160 9be78fc0023d72adbaca76feca5a5dfc600976e7 SHA1 01b020ce75fdad7ceab0d6cf3b971107031cb264 SHA256 c48f1d43aa5eb2f3374c54e1be22241c09bc94d9fd2156794be28f7b09af4bac -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-iQIcBAEBAgAGBQJP8PcaAAoJEKXdFCfdEflKJ24QAIXC0oeYIal38Ul5YWoJtmlJ -LDejSTxA5XGrUmhKQLV25r47J8NAeNu5e32JQYjICJhjCT9wMyqfpkgJ/CmPPUHl -TPhjJ2h+CPf6FaE/xk46aHIcCnahjvYj6Gwe/Q554CtuNNXGJ/yP5aO/4So8Brck -Mf+fUoXMueaZlqPfTVyHKG00udjQvf4kmG7c4NRXmdkvWLk8EGMta9S+wUoW8vQN -ZKmQgj6rFHLwjU0JaRUGCWsWleJ6viV1Ie+NaZWlgEyrPHiCqyTPjDmN8gugPcuL -KOQhEOsLJ2MB8W2hfW293leWtH4zqZL/7Rx26FQB/ueKqJGju/BNAGhdG7kx0w9q -rVG22AywB9xZJfzwHFJKCWxL011klqKDxuB8HqIFm/TqdL6Cs/wqf9w9Suxl+oWp -zZb1pZJ1JLx+rxh686ye6JZl6kdXdADPvPSUhHujXAZ2Xly1Q1DnIitYZ9Oz5nT0 -kIOsC5WJNhAkx1jjcHi/rjiVVdK7O7PBBV2C59Af9NlD0XRuhB8mNeotioPkPTxa -lYrpys11h/oT9vJR8GpZlQyHHQ2CzvkV5UTQPwbeadro0+kNMdWrKhj0/3fgY5az -/pLQsMn+SQ5mYQdaKrXq5eACn/rw+AlmwD00fUg/H98EkT7jlAlhXrBoKqH/xJ8Q -D/iqLQCXtOarfNvGSEDt -=rpQ0 +iQIcBAEBAgAGBQJP83HqAAoJEKXdFCfdEflKGUcP/3br7LEoYyiCrDH9hBz6YZ7E +IrP3qdTAlqo4CrxReKbz7Ld74l6goR1WoCbCD8s/XUgqk9pXejhe8osaONDK4S31 +uO5lXnDu+hkiMktOL9iUsiYYyLtPAQXQleIjyXbcPbQI6n9Uz6WypPRdhWJ7zc4A +4WN6Y7te5BUFttkNFnCIXpGrKkAuttLFu9EXQBmiTm4WY1Ox85BajeCxSR5dQ9Ub +kucQfxaULg+KMVp1YYS2Ocu2SkSV8EXaVombHGnPXRX6dFAA4hFNsNTxzzOayq4C +4ydr8nhwLuFzx+vO85lFoxYovwEjZ65tNbGkj2vqGafsT7CfFTNjxbbNetzcz0ki +0HV91ruEjF8HFw+fCFoL231QSmaswDnLjejdB5FwaLLZ/MkF8tT4YclIonE94nkk +I54Won8SM+AC4XNur0qJk/8ZUp6Q/X/K/XbevaFuPqAhfOlIyBiRVMMFIEYNjTQb +JgKWUazrTrcfXuFqWAcy71KuceOrbjffMsYHECBw3LujRlIMOHrOvmpflyJ+gjYs +KcCBtEOcLqkOmh9rMweArzp0P/GOvDSjKIGtEgnfu5yPfE8r2jBmceyIQT/9/AYy +bD1WBaQWLU2cI5noo11Zh9M+wg0TyU6bo8Awi+p+gh8ylMmYgquiwfhOdhFftBSY +I8OR7F85Ewg7fDV4O1kV +=KDAN -----END PGP SIGNATURE----- diff --git a/app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ild b/app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ild index d61fb35bb452..6469ef472987 100644 --- a/app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ild +++ b/app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ild,v 1.2 2012/07/02 01:19:04 zerochaos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-crypt/hashcat-bin/hashcat-bin-0.39.ebuild,v 1.3 2012/07/03 22:27:31 zerochaos Exp $ EAPI=4 @@ -30,7 +30,7 @@ QA_PREBUILT="hashcat-cli*.bin" src_install() { dodoc docs/* - rm -rf *.exe docs + rm -rf *.exe docs || die use x86 && rm hashcat-cli64.bin use amd64 && rm hashcat-cli32.bin @@ -40,23 +40,27 @@ src_install() { insinto /opt/${PN} doins -r "${S}"/* - dodir /usr/bin + dodir /opt/bin if [ -f "${ED}"/opt/${PN}/hashcat-cli32.bin ] then fperms +x /opt/${PN}/hashcat-cli32.bin - echo '#! /bin/sh' > "${ED}"/usr/bin/hashcat-cli32.bin - echo 'cd /opt/hashcat-bin' >> "${ED}"/usr/bin/hashcat-cli32.bin - echo 'echo "Warning: hashcat-cli32.bin is running from $(pwd) so be careful of relative paths."' >> "${ED}"/usr/bin/hashcat-cli32.bin - echo './hashcat-cli32.bin $@' >> "${ED}"/usr/bin/hashcat-cli32.bin - fperms +x /usr/bin/hashcat-cli32.bin + cat <<-EOF > "${ED}"/opt/bin/hashcat-cli32.bin + #! /bin/sh + cd /opt/${PN} + echo "Warning: hashcat-cli32.bin is running from /opt/${PN} so be careful of relative paths." + ./hashcat-cli32.bin $@ + EOF + fperms +x /opt/bin/hashcat-cli32.bin fi if [ -f "${ED}"/opt/${PN}/hashcat-cli64.bin ] then fperms +x /opt/${PN}/hashcat-cli64.bin - echo '#! /bin/sh' > "${ED}"/usr/bin/hashcat-cli64.bin - echo 'cd /opt/hashcat-bin' >> "${ED}"/usr/bin/hashcat-cli64.bin - echo 'echo "Warning: hashcat-cli64.bin is running from $(pwd) so be careful of relative paths."' >> "${ED}"/usr/bin/hashcat-cli64.bin - echo './hashcat-cli64.bin $@' >> "${ED}"/usr/bin/hashcat-cli64.bin - fperms +x /usr/bin/hashcat-cli64.bin + cat <<-EOF > "${ED}"/opt/bin/hashcat-cli64.bin + #! /bin/sh + cd /opt/${PN} + echo "Warning: hashcat-cli64.bin is running from /opt/${PN} so be careful of relative paths." + ./hashcat-cli64.bin $@ + EOF + fperms +x /opt/bin/hashcat-cli64.bin fi } |